Re: Dev-Textures for Map Editing.
I think you simply lost them in termanology Leo. Folks. these are not textures meant to stay visable. you replace em with other textures after you finished making that part of your game. these make it easier to see what you are working on during the Dev eloppement phase, thus the term Dev-Texture. Re: How to copy a map on-to another
What grim is saying it to use the command called mapenlarge. this will double the area of your map.
Just press the button normally found above your tab key, this should bring up the command promp with a /
then type in mapenlarge and hit enter
voila more room.
